The Escalation
Clyde and his ex-wife Stephanie (Kyra Sedgwick) grow alarmed. Doctors find nothing physically wrong, but Emily’s behavior worsens. She develops a violent tremor in her right hand, speaks in a deep, guttural voice, and becomes hostile, especially toward her sister. At school, a terrifying incident occurs when Emily, seemingly in a trance, attacks a larger girl who bumped into her, pinning her down with inhuman force.
The family’s final breaking point comes when Emily, fully possessed, levitates above her bed, her body contorting unnaturally. Stephanie is thrown across the room, and the room’s temperature plummets.
